Final Year Project (FYP), Nanyang Technological University, Singapore. https://hdl.handle.net/10356/149018 | Abstract: | The aim of this project is to configure and produce whole-sky imagers based on the WAHRSIS 6 as well as to perform image processing to perform cloud movement prediction. This report provides documentation regarding the configuration of the whole-sky imagers and the methods and results from image processing. This report will consist of five parts, beginning with an introduction of whole sky imagers and the WAHRSIS 6 and the objective of the project. The next section will describe the hardware and software components, followed by an explanation of the methods and steps in configuring the software. Next, the results of the captured images and image processing for cloud analysis will be shown and evaluated and ending with a conclusion of the project. | URI: | https://hdl.handle.net/10356/149018 | Fulltext Permission: | restricted | Fulltext Availability: | With Fulltext |
